Maggie Williams Miss Arkansas Teen USA 2019, Contestant Miss Teen USA 2019

14 Apr 2019 | Irina Silva

On November 18th 2018, at the finale of the state pageant held at ArcBest Performing Arts Center in Fort Smith, Arkansas, Maggie Williams emerged the winner and was crowned Miss Arkansas Teen USA 2019. She succeeded and was crowned by her predecessor Mackenzie Hinderberger, Miss Arkansas Teen USA 2018. Runners-up at the state finale were Daly Dacus (first runner-up), Mary-Kate Jones (second runner-up), Rylie Wagner (third runner-up) and Abigail Davis (fourth runner-up). Maggie also won the Best Gown award and Miss Congeniality award at the finale.

Maggie, who is 17 years of age and hails from Piggott, is no doubt one of the best faces amongst this year’s contestants for Miss Teen USA 2019. The ravishing beauty with a stunning smile definitely has what it takes to win the national title this year. Arkansas has won till date only one Miss Teen USA title, and that was in the year 2008, when Stevi Perry was crowned Miss Teen USA 2008. Maggie is currently studying at Piggott High School and after finishing high school, she desires to double major in Political Science and Criminology to pursue a law degree. Besides, she also leads her high school tennis team as the highest ranked female singles player. She describes herself as strong, bold, and compassionate and loves to travel and explore the world. Besides being an outdoors enthusiast, she also loves reading, writing, politics, making a difference and all things related to health.
